Roof covering battens, or furring strips, are thin strips of wood, plastic or steel that are made use of to supply an attachment point for the roofing product. They are most commonly used with clay, rock, or concrete floor tiles. Any roof covering that is developed to mirror more sunlight and soak up less warm than a common roofing is called a "awesome roofing (https://packersmovers.activeboard.com/t67151553/how-to-connect-canon-mg3620-printer-to-computer/?ts=1708637605&direction=prev&page=last#lastPostAnchor)." Amazing roofing systems are optimized with coatings, light reflective shades, or high solar reflectance to be energy reliable.

Roof covering outdoor decking, or sheathing, is the solid layer of timber that is laid on top of the rafters and comes to be the base layer for any type of roof covering. Decks are most often constructed from plywood sheets or stand board (OSB). A home window that forecasts from a sloping roof. Originated from the latin word "dormitorium," for resting space.


Dormer, A downspout is a pipe, typically at the edges of the roof covering, that brings water from the rain gutters to the ground level. Gutters connected to the eaves of the roofing system carry water to the downspout which routes water to the ground or to a drainpipe at ground degree. Steel blinking used at the sides of the roof designed to control the direction of trickling water is called a drip side.




The eaves are the edges of the roofing that hang over or beyond the vertical wall surfaces of a structure. Their major objective is to direct water away from the structure itself.
